Dividing a File
Dividing a file at the current position

You can divide a file in the stop mode, so that the file is divided into two parts
and new file numbers are added to the divided file names. By dividing a file,
you can easily find the point from which you want to play back when you make
a long recording such as one made at a meeting. You can divide a file until the
total number of files in the folder reaches the maximum number allowed.
Stop the file at the position where you want to divide a file.
Press and hold BACK/HOME to display the
Home menu, then select
Edit”
“Edit
Files
“Divide at Current Position, and
then press /ENT.
“Divide at Current Position?” will be displayed.
Press or to select YES, and then press /ENT.
The “Please Wait” animation appears, and the file is divided. The divided
files will be suffixed with a sequential number (“_1” for the original file,
and “_2” for the new file).
A file is divided.
File 1 File 2 File 3
File 2_2File 2_1File 1 File 3
A suffix made up of a sequential number is
added to a file name of the divided files.
Press STOP to exit the menu mode.
To cancel dividing
Select “NO” in step , and then press /ENT.
